Israeli officials and the populace at-large are expressing satisfaction over last week’s Gallup Poll showing strong support for the Israel-side over the Palestinian-side in the conflict. The 63% rating was the highest for the Jewish state since 1991. Only 15% indicated support for the Palestinian position over Israel. In a statement issued by Prime Minister Binyamin Netanyahu’s office, the Israeli administration used the Gallup results to chide the Palestinians into returning to the negotiating table, saying, “It would be a shame for them to waste time in a futile wait for Israel’s diplomatic isolation in the US.” An official in the prime minister’s office credited Netanyahu with the strong support of the American public.
